Gather And Organize Financial Information
Just like detectives, tax associates hunt for relevant financial data. They collect, sort, and organize this data meticulously, ensuring every transaction is accurately recorded. This is the groundwork that shapes the entire tax process.
File Tax Returns And Ensure Compliance
Transforming into administrators, tax associates are responsible for filing accurate tax returns on behalf of their clients. They cross-check every detail against existing tax laws, ensuring full compliance. Any tiny error could lead to hefty penalties!

Lastly, tax associates turn into diligent scholars, always studying and interpreting tax laws. They’re constantly on the lookout for ways to minimize tax liabilities, aiming to identify saving opportunities. This rigorous research allows them to develop strategic tax-saving plans for their clients.
Communicate Complex Tax Concepts To Clients
As excellent communicators, tax associates possess the gift of making complex tax laws seem simple. They translate the jargon-filled tax world into an understandable language, helping clients grasp their tax situation and obligations clearly.
Assist Clients During Tax Audits
In the event of a tax audit, a tax associate acts as a supportive ally. They assist clients in gathering needed documents, preparing responses, and navigating the audit process, ensuring a smooth and less stressful experience.
Represent Clients In Interactions With Tax Authorities
When interacting with tax authorities, tax associates step in to represent their clients. They ensure that the client’s rights are upheld and negotiations are conducted in the client’s best interests, effectively acting as their voice in the tax realm.

Strong Knowledge Of Tax Laws
For a tax associate, having an extensive understanding of tax laws is non-negotiable. They need to be updated about current tax regulations, changes, and implications. This knowledge allows them to navigate tax compliance effectively and devise beneficial tax strategies.
Proficiency In Accounting And Financial Analysis
Tax associates must be well-versed in accounting principles and financial analysis. These skills enable them to accurately gather and interpret financial data, prepare tax returns, and identify potential tax savings. This proficiency forms the backbone of their daily responsibilities.
Attention To Detail And Analytical Thinking

In the tax world, details matter! Tax associates require a keen eye to spot anomalies, understand patterns, and ensure accuracy. Their analytical thinking helps them make sense of complex financial data and predict future tax implications.
Effective Communication And Interpersonal Skills
As tax associates often explain complex tax concepts to clients, effective communication is crucial. Good interpersonal skills help them build strong, trusting relationships with their clients.
Continuous Learning And Adaptability
The tax landscape is ever-changing. Hence, a successful tax associate is always learning, and staying updated on tax law changes. Their adaptability allows them to adjust strategies accordingly, ensuring optimal outcomes for their clients.

1. What Are The Duties Of A Tax Associate?
A tax associate’s duties are multifaceted. They gather and organize financial data, file tax returns while ensuring compliance with laws, research tax regulations to identify savings opportunities, and communicate complex tax concepts to clients. They also assist clients during tax audits and represent them in interactions with tax authorities.
2. What Does A Tax Associate Do At PWC?
At PWC, a tax associate handles similar responsibilities as mentioned above, with a focus on serving PWC’s wide range of clients. They also work with senior associates on specific projects, leverage PWC’s resources for tax research, and receive continuous training to stay updated with the evolving tax environment.
3. What Is The Highest Salary Of A Tax Associate?
The salary of a tax associate can vary significantly based on factors like location, years of experience, and the specific company. In the U.S., some senior tax associates or those with significant experience at large firms could earn over $100,000 per year.
